Harry Truman: We will carry on the fight for the full protection of civil rights to all of our citizens in all parts of the country…

On the recordJuly 25, 1952
We will carry on the fight for the full protection of civil rights to all of our citizens in all parts of the country, without regard to race, religion, or national origin.
Said by
Harry Truman
Democratic · Missouri

Editor's note · Context

Address in Chicago at the Democratic National Convention.
